It is undeniable that there are many snafu’s surrounding the use of LED lights, especially in wall packs. Depending on the type of glass used, the situation discerning the lighting, an LED wall pack may or may not fit the bill. If constructed using clear or frosted non-prismatic lenses there really are no issues concerning lighting. It is only when the request for prismatic or borosilicate glass comes in to play that the consumer finds a deficiency in the life and production of light. Prismatic glass causes the LED light to have to refract itself at different angles against the surface. This causes an impediment in luminosity. Using clear or frosted glass eliminates this impediment.
Other cons to using these wall packs in place of say induction lighting sources include higher cost and larger quantity for effect, less luminairies output then other light sources, and LED wall packs or any light using this type of bulb are quite sensitive to changes in temperature-especially heat. Heat rises, this can lead problems with the lighting and a shortened lifespan of the pack when used in manufacturing and business settings that are exposed to prolonged high levels of heat.
While the above factors should play a role in the decision for the business, it doesn’t always outweigh the benefits. In most cases, LED lighting is a leader in the industry. It has a longer life expectancy of those that have come before it. It is brighter than the average bulb. It powers up after shutdown quicker and reaches its full potential of luminosity in a less amount of time. It experiences less color diminishment as it ages and has less of a variance in colors.
This means that a set of LED wall packs will look the same color when lighting an area which can provide a clearer field of vision as well as boost aesthetic value. For the most part an LED wall pack will give more light for a larger amount of time than any other light on the market. There will always be new innovations in any industry.
